HIP 78387

HIP 78387 is a K-type (Orange) star located in the constellation Hercules.

Located approximately 434.9 light-years from Earth, HIP 78387 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 78387 is classified as a spectral class K star (K-type (Orange)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 78387 has an apparent magnitude of +6.78,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its orange h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+1.165.
